B.A. in Stage Management
One of the few programs in the US designed exclusively to train you for stage and company management career, the Stage Management program at the Pace University blends in-class instruction with practical experience and connections to professional opportunities in New York City.

About the Course
- Build and strengthen the core skills you’ll need to transition into the professional world of theater and film.
- Learn how to communicate and problem-solve though a broad range of hands-on experiences.
- Gain an understanding of the essential technical elements of stage management, including rehearsal and production technique, union rules, and touring. You’ll also learn production management for theater and live events.
The Stage Management program at the Pace University prepares you for careers in stage, production, and company management through a focused four-year program that builds and strengthens the core skills needed to transition into the professional world of theater and film. Along with courses in acting, directing, and design the program offers courses emphasizing communication, prioritization, organizational and problem-solving skills, technical knowledge, familiarity with union rules as well as multiple practicums as production stage managers and assistant stage managers.
Courses Included
- Script Analysis for BA Actor and Director
- Directing for BA Director
- Directing Lab for BA Director
- Drafting
- Stage Management
- Stage Lighting
- Sound and Story
